Output 650669c3c200ae66cee4da3d9eb778432d76fd4ff1ef3a32bb754568c2ee589a:1

value
27247215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7cb8fadd5549d8508cddd08c07e1b4b7038dd2a1367d01536d25b6c5137c2979
address
bc1p0ju04h24f8v9prxa6zxq0cd5kupcm54pxe7sz5mdykmv2ymu99us6xz66u
transaction
650669c3c200ae66cee4da3d9eb778432d76fd4ff1ef3a32bb754568c2ee589a
confirmations
73275
spent
true